For some reason, out of the gate, I struggled a bit with them and wondered if I had made a huge mistake, given the huge price tag. However, as I have settled in, I now absolutely love them. They are the best iron shaft that I have ever played. The play for me much like a Recoil Proto or SteelFiber, but feel more smooth. They hold up really well to my quick transition. The trajectory and launch window are what I want.
I know that the demand is not all that large for a shaft that costs so much, particularly when there are so many options available at a more affordable price, but I wish there were a way for more to try them, because they are so good.
